The CO₂ Emissions Analyzer for Canning is a practical and informative tool designed for artisanal laboratories, farms, and food producers who wish to monitor and estimate carbon dioxide (CO₂) emissions associated with processing and packaging.
The app allows users to quantify the environmental impact related to the consumption of electricity, gas, and transportation, providing indicative values for total emissions and per kilogram of finished product.

Purpose and Utility

Monitoring CO₂ production is increasingly important for companies aiming for environmental sustainability and ecological traceability.
This tool helps identify critical points in the production process and estimate how different stages (cooking, pasteurization, transportation) contribute to the overall carbon footprint.

Key Features

  • Input of consumption for:
    • Electricity (kWh);
    • Natural gas or LPG (m³);
    • Distance and amount transported (to estimate road transport);
  • Automatic calculation of emissions:
    • for each consumption item;
    • total in kg of CO₂;
    • CO₂ per kg of finished product (if the produced quantity is entered);
